Full Lift Technology

The device will start to open as soon as the set pressure is reached and only requires 10% overpressure to full lift Carrera Lift is the actual travel of the valve pallet from the main valve out of the closed position. . Continuous investments in and a commitment to research and development have allowed PROTEGO® to develop a low pressure valve which has the same opening characteristic as a high pressure safety relief valve. This “Full Lift Type” technology allows the valve to be set at just 10% below the maximum allowable working pressure or vacuum (MAWP or MAWV) of the tank and still safely vent the required mass flow. The opening characteristic is the same for pressure and vacuum relief.
